+# Changelog for [`base` package](http://hackage.haskell.org/package/base)
+
+## 4.20.0.1 *May 2024*
+  * Not shipped with any GHC: This is a documentation only release to fix various issues with base-4.20.0.0 docs due to the GHC internal split
+  * For an accounting of the issues fixed, see [#24875](https://gitlab.haskell.org/ghc/ghc/-/issues/24875)
+
+## 4.20.0.0 *May 2024*
+  * Shipped with GHC 9.10.1
+  * Deprecate `GHC.Pack` ([#21461](https://gitlab.haskell.org/ghc/ghc/-/issues/21461))
+  * Export `foldl'` from `Prelude` ([CLC proposal #167](https://github.com/haskell/core-libraries-committee/issues/167))
+  * The top-level handler for uncaught exceptions now displays the output of `displayException` rather than `show`  ([CLC proposal #198](https://github.com/haskell/core-libraries-committee/issues/198))
+  * Add `permutations` and `permutations1` to `Data.List.NonEmpty` ([CLC proposal #68](https://github.com/haskell/core-libraries-committee/issues/68))
+  * Add a `RULE` to `Prelude.lookup`, allowing it to participate in list fusion ([CLC proposal #175](https://github.com/haskell/core-libraries-committee/issues/175))
+  * Implement `stimes` for `instance Semigroup (Endo a)` explicitly ([CLC proposal #4](https://github.com/haskell/core-libraries-committee/issues/4))
+  * Add `startTimeProfileAtStartup` to `GHC.RTS.Flags` to expose new RTS flag
+    `--no-automatic-heap-samples` in the Haskell API ([CLC proposal #243](https://github.com/haskell/core-libraries-committee/issues/243)).
+  * Implement `sconcat` for `instance Semigroup Data.Semigroup.First` and `instance Semigroup Data.Monoid.First` explicitly, increasing laziness ([CLC proposal #246](https://github.com/haskell/core-libraries-committee/issues/246))
+  * Add laws relating between `Foldable` / `Traversable` with `Bifoldable` / `Bitraversable` ([CLC proposal #205](https://github.com/haskell/core-libraries-committee/issues/205))
+  * The `Enum Int64` and `Enum Word64` instances now use native operations on 32-bit platforms, increasing performance by up to 1.5x on i386 and up to 5.6x with the JavaScript backend. ([CLC proposal #187](https://github.com/haskell/core-libraries-committee/issues/187))
+  * Exceptions can now be decorated with user-defined annotations via `ExceptionContext`.
+  * Exceptions now capture backtrace information via their `ExceptionContext`. GHC
+    supports several mechanisms by which backtraces can be collected which can be
+    individually enabled and disabled via
+    `GHC.Exception.Backtrace.setBacktraceMechanismState`.
+  * Update to [Unicode 15.1.0](https://www.unicode.org/versions/Unicode15.1.0/).
+  * Fix `withFile`, `withFileBlocking`, and `withBinaryFile` to not incorrectly annotate exceptions raised in wrapped computation. ([CLC proposal #237](https://github.com/haskell/core-libraries-committee/issues/237))
+  * Fix `fdIsNonBlocking` to always be `0` for regular files and block devices on unix, regardless of `O_NONBLOCK`
+  * Always use `safe` call to `read` for regular files and block devices on unix if the RTS is multi-threaded, regardless of `O_NONBLOCK`.
+    ([CLC proposal #166](https://github.com/haskell/core-libraries-committee/issues/166))
+  * Export List from Data.List ([CLC proposal #182](https://github.com/haskell/core-libraries-committee/issues/182)).
+  * Add `{-# WARNING in "x-data-list-nonempty-unzip" #-}` to `Data.List.NonEmpty.unzip`.
+    Use `{-# OPTIONS_GHC -Wno-x-data-list-nonempty-unzip #-}` to disable it.
+     ([CLC proposal #86](https://github.com/haskell/core-libraries-committee/issues/86)
+     and [CLC proposal #258](https://github.com/haskell/core-libraries-committee/issues/258))
+  * Add `System.Mem.performMajorGC` ([CLC proposal #230](https://github.com/haskell/core-libraries-committee/issues/230))
+  * Fix exponent overflow/underflow bugs in the `Read` instances for `Float` and `Double` ([CLC proposal #192](https://github.com/haskell/core-libraries-committee/issues/192))
+  * `Foreign.C.Error.errnoToIOError` now uses the reentrant `strerror_r` to render system errors when possible ([CLC proposal #249](https://github.com/haskell/core-libraries-committee/issues/249))
+  * Implement `many` and `some` methods of `instance Alternative (Compose f g)` explicitly. ([CLC proposal #181](https://github.com/haskell/core-libraries-committee/issues/181))
+  * Change the types of the `GHC.Stack.StackEntry.closureType` and `GHC.InfoProv.InfoProv.ipDesc` record fields to use `GHC.Exts.Heap.ClosureType` rather than an `Int`.
+    To recover the old value use `fromEnum`. ([CLC proposal #210](https://github.com/haskell/core-libraries-committee/issues/210))
+
+  * The functions `GHC.Exts.dataToTag#` and `GHC.Base.getTag` have had
+    their types changed to the following:
+
+    ```haskell
+    dataToTag#, getTag
+      :: forall {lev :: Levity} (a :: TYPE (BoxedRep lev))
+      .  DataToTag a => a -> Int#
+    ```
+
+    In particular, they are now applicable only at some (not all)
+    lifted types.  However, if `t` is an algebraic data type (i.e. `t`
+    matches a `data` or `data instance` declaration) with all of its
+    constructors in scope and the levity of `t` is statically known,
+    then the constraint `DataToTag t` can always be solved.
+  * `GHC.Exts` no longer exports the GHC-internal `whereFrom#` primop ([CLC proposal #214](https://github.com/haskell/core-libraries-committee/issues/214))
+  * `GHC.InfoProv.InfoProv` now provides a `ipUnitId :: String` field encoding the unit ID of the unit defining the info table ([CLC proposal #214](https://github.com/haskell/core-libraries-committee/issues/214))
+
+    ([CLC proposal #104](https://github.com/haskell/core-libraries-committee/issues/104))
+  * Add `sortOn` to `Data.List.NonEmpty`
+    ([CLC proposal #227](https://github.com/haskell/core-libraries-committee/issues/227))
+
+  * Add more instances for `Compose`: `Fractional`, `RealFrac`, `Floating`, `RealFloat` ([CLC proposal #226](https://github.com/haskell/core-libraries-committee/issues/226))
+
+  * Treat all FDs as "nonblocking" on wasm32 ([CLC proposal #234](https://github.com/haskell/core-libraries-committee/issues/234))
+
+  * Add `HeapByEra`, `eraSelector` and `automaticEraIncrement` to `GHC.RTS.Flags` to
+    reflect the new RTS flags: `-he` profiling mode, `-he` selector and `--automatic-era-increment`.
+    ([CLC proposal #254](https://github.com/haskell/core-libraries-committee/issues/254))
+
+## 4.19.0.0 *October 2023*
+  * Add `{-# WARNING in "x-partial" #-}` to `Data.List.{head,tail}`.
+    Use `{-# OPTIONS_GHC -Wno-x-partial #-}` to disable it.
+    ([CLC proposal #87](https://github.com/haskell/core-libraries-committee/issues/87) and [#114](https://github.com/haskell/core-libraries-committee/issues/114))
+  * Add `fromThreadId :: ThreadId -> Word64` to `GHC.Conc.Sync`, which maps a thread to a per-process-unique identifier ([CLC proposal #117](https://github.com/haskell/core-libraries-committee/issues/117))
+  * Add `Data.List.!?` ([CLC proposal #110](https://github.com/haskell/core-libraries-committee/issues/110))
+  * Mark `maximumBy`/`minimumBy` as `INLINE` improving performance for unpackable
+    types significantly.
+  * Add INLINABLE pragmas to `generic*` functions in Data.OldList ([CLC proposal #129](https://github.com/haskell/core-libraries-committee/issues/130))
+  * Export `getSolo` from `Data.Tuple`.
+      ([CLC proposal #113](https://github.com/haskell/core-libraries-committee/issues/113))
+  * Add `Type.Reflection.decTypeRep`, `Data.Typeable.decT` and `Data.Typeable.hdecT` equality decisions functions.
+      ([CLC proposal #98](https://github.com/haskell/core-libraries-committee/issues/98))
+  * Add `Data.Functor.unzip` ([CLC proposal #88](https://github.com/haskell/core-libraries-committee/issues/88))
+  * Add `System.Mem.Weak.{get,set}FinalizerExceptionHandler`, which allows the user to set the global handler invoked by when a `Weak` pointer finalizer throws an exception. ([CLC proposal #126](https://github.com/haskell/core-libraries-committee/issues/126))
+  * Add `System.Mem.Weak.printToHandleFinalizerExceptionHandler`, which can be used with `setFinalizerExceptionHandler` to print exceptions thrown by finalizers to the given `Handle`. ([CLC proposal #126](https://github.com/haskell/core-libraries-committee/issues/126))
+  * Add `Data.List.unsnoc` ([CLC proposal #165](https://github.com/haskell/core-libraries-committee/issues/165))
+  * Implement more members of `instance Foldable (Compose f g)` explicitly.
+      ([CLC proposal #57](https://github.com/haskell/core-libraries-committee/issues/57))
+  * Add `Eq` and `Ord` instances for `SSymbol`, `SChar`, and `SNat`.
+      ([CLC proposal #148](https://github.com/haskell/core-libraries-committee/issues/148))
+  * Add `COMPLETE` pragmas to the `TypeRep`, `SSymbol`, `SChar`, and `SNat` pattern synonyms.
+      ([CLC proposal #149](https://github.com/haskell/core-libraries-committee/issues/149))
+  * Make `($)` representation polymorphic ([CLC proposal #132](https://github.com/haskell/core-libraries-committee/issues/132))
+  * Implement [GHC Proposal #433](https://github.com/ghc-proposals/ghc-proposals/blob/master/proposals/0433-unsatisfiable.rst),
+    adding the class `Unsatisfiable :: ErrorMessage -> TypeError` to `GHC.TypeError`,
+    which provides a mechanism for custom type errors that reports the errors in
+    a more predictable behaviour than `TypeError`.
+  * Add more instances for `Compose`: `Enum`, `Bounded`, `Num`, `Real`, `Integral` ([CLC proposal #160](https://github.com/haskell/core-libraries-committee/issues/160))
+  * Make `(&)` representation polymorphic in the return type ([CLC proposal #158](https://github.com/haskell/core-libraries-committee/issues/158))
+  * Implement `GHC.IORef.atomicSwapIORef` via a new dedicated primop `atomicSwapMutVar#` ([CLC proposal #139](https://github.com/haskell/core-libraries-committee/issues/139))
+  * Change `BufferCodec` to use an unboxed implementation, while providing a compatibility layer using pattern synonyms. ([CLC proposal #134](https://github.com/haskell/core-libraries-committee/issues/134))
+  * Add nominal role annotations to `SNat` / `SSymbol` / `SChar` ([CLC proposal #170](https://github.com/haskell/core-libraries-committee/issues/170))
+  * Make `Semigroup`'s `stimes` specializable. ([CLC proposal #8](https://github.com/haskell/core-libraries-committee/issues/8))
+  * Implement `copyBytes`, `fillBytes`, `moveBytes` and `stimes` for `Data.Array.Byte.ByteArray` using primops ([CLC proposal #188](https://github.com/haskell/core-libraries-committee/issues/188))
+  * Add rewrite rules for conversion between `Int64` / `Word64` and `Float` / `Double` on 64-bit architectures ([CLC proposal #203](https://github.com/haskell/core-libraries-committee/issues/203)).
+  * `Generic` instances for tuples now expose `Unit`, `Tuple2`, `Tuple3`, ..., `Tuple64` as the actual names for tuple type constructors ([GHC proposal #475](https://github.com/ghc-proposals/ghc-proposals/blob/master/proposals/0475-tuple-syntax.rst)).
+
+## 4.18.0.0 *March 2023*
+  * Shipped with GHC 9.6.1
+  * `Foreign.C.ConstPtr.ConstrPtr` was added to encode `const`-qualified
+    pointer types in foreign declarations when using `CApiFFI` extension. ([CLC proposal #117](https://github.com/haskell/core-libraries-committee/issues/117))
+  * Add `forall a. Functor (p a)` superclass for `Bifunctor p` ([CLC proposal #91](https://github.com/haskell/core-libraries-committee/issues/91))
+  * Add `forall a. Functor (p a)` superclass for `Bifunctor p`.
+  * Add Functor instances for `(,,,,) a b c d`, `(,,,,,) a b c d e` and
+    `(,,,,,) a b c d e f`.
+  * Exceptions thrown by weak pointer finalizers can now be reported by setting
+    a global exception handler, using `System.Mem.Weak.setFinalizerExceptionHandler`.
+    The default behaviour is unchanged (exceptions are ignored and not reported).
+  * `Numeric.Natural` re-exports `GHC.Natural.minusNaturalMaybe`
+    ([CLC proposal #45](https://github.com/haskell/core-libraries-committee/issues/45))
+  * Add `Data.Foldable1` and `Data.Bifoldable1`
+    ([CLC proposal #9](https://github.com/haskell/core-libraries-committee/issues/9))
+  * Add `applyWhen` to `Data.Function`
+    ([CLC proposal #71](https://github.com/haskell/core-libraries-committee/issues/71))
+  * Add functions `mapAccumM` and `forAccumM` to `Data.Traversable`
+    ([CLC proposal #65](https://github.com/haskell/core-libraries-committee/issues/65))
+  * Add default implementation of `(<>)` in terms of `sconcat` and `mempty` in
+    terms of `mconcat` ([CLC proposal #61](https://github.com/haskell/core-libraries-committee/issues/61)).
+  * `GHC.Conc.Sync.listThreads` was added, allowing the user to list the threads
+    (both running and blocked) of the program.
+  * `GHC.Conc.Sync.labelThreadByteArray#` was added, allowing the user to specify
+    a thread label by way of a `ByteArray#` containing a UTF-8-encoded string.
+    The old `GHC.Conc.Sync.labelThread` is now implemented in terms of this
+    function.
+  * `GHC.Conc.Sync.threadLabel` was added, allowing the user to query the label
+    of a given `ThreadId`.
+  * Add `inits1` and `tails1` to `Data.List.NonEmpty`
+    ([CLC proposal #67](https://github.com/haskell/core-libraries-committee/issues/67))
+  * Change default `Ord` implementation of `(>=)`, `(>)`, and `(<)` to use
+    `(<=)` instead of `compare` ([CLC proposal #24](https://github.com/haskell/core-libraries-committee/issues/24)).
+  * Export `liftA2` from `Prelude`. This means that the entirety of `Applicative`
+    is now exported from `Prelude`
+    ([CLC proposal #50](https://github.com/haskell/core-libraries-committee/issues/50),
+    [the migration
+    guide](https://github.com/haskell/core-libraries-committee/blob/main/guides/export-lifta2-prelude.md))
+  * Switch to a pure Haskell implementation of `GHC.Unicode`
+    ([CLC proposals #59](https://github.com/haskell/core-libraries-committee/issues/59)
+    and [#130](https://github.com/haskell/core-libraries-committee/issues/130))
+  * Update to [Unicode 15.0.0](https://www.unicode.org/versions/Unicode15.0.0/).
+  * Add standard Unicode case predicates `isUpperCase` and `isLowerCase` to
+    `GHC.Unicode` and `Data.Char`. These predicates use the standard Unicode
+    case properties and are more intuitive than `isUpper` and `isLower`
+    ([CLC proposal #90](https://github.com/haskell/core-libraries-committee/issues/90))
+  * Add `Eq` and `Ord` instances for `Generically1`.
+  * Relax instances for Functor combinators; put superclass on Class1 and Class2
+    to make non-breaking ([CLC proposal #10](https://github.com/haskell/core-libraries-committee/issues/10),
+    [migration guide](https://github.com/haskell/core-libraries-committee/blob/main/guides/functor-combinator-instances-and-class1s.md))
+  * Add `gcdetails_block_fragmentation_bytes` to `GHC.Stats.GCDetails` to track heap fragmentation.
+  * `GHC.TypeLits` and `GHC.TypeNats` now export the `natSing`, `symbolSing`,
+    and `charSing` methods of `KnownNat`, `KnownSymbol`, and `KnownChar`,
+    respectively. They also export the `SNat`, `SSymbol`, and `SChar` types
+    that are used in these methods and provide an API to interact with these
+    types, per
+    [CLC proposal #85](https://github.com/haskell/core-libraries-committee/issues/85).
+  * The `Enum` instance of `Down a` now enumerates values in the opposite
+    order as the `Enum a` instance ([CLC proposal #51](https://github.com/haskell/core-libraries-committee/issues/51))
+  * `Foreign.Marshal.Pool` now uses the RTS internal arena instead of libc
+    `malloc` for allocation. It avoids the O(n) overhead of maintaining a list
+    of individually allocated pointers as well as freeing each one of them when
+    freeing a `Pool` (#14762, #18338)
+  * `Type.Reflection.Unsafe` is now marked as unsafe.
+  * Add `Data.Typeable.heqT`, a kind-heterogeneous version of
+    `Data.Typeable.eqT`
+    ([CLC proposal #99](https://github.com/haskell/core-libraries-committee/issues/99))
+  * Various declarations GHC's new info-table provenance feature have been
+    moved from `GHC.Stack.CCS` to a new `GHC.InfoProv` module:
+    * The `InfoProv`, along its `ipName`, `ipDesc`, `ipTyDesc`, `ipLabel`,
+      `ipMod`, and `ipLoc` fields, have been moved.
+    * `InfoProv` now has additional `ipSrcFile` and `ipSrcSpan` fields. `ipLoc`
+      is now a function computed from these fields.
+    * The `whereFrom` function has been moved
+  * Add functions `traceWith`, `traceShowWith`, `traceEventWith` to
+    `Debug.Trace`, per
+    [CLC proposal #36](https://github.com/haskell/core-libraries-committee/issues/36).
+  * Export `List` from `GHC.List`
+    ([CLC proposal #186](https://github.com/haskell/core-libraries-committee/issues/186)).
+
+## 4.17.0.0 *August 2022*
+
+  * Shipped with GHC 9.4.1
+
+  * Add explicitly bidirectional `pattern TypeRep` to `Type.Reflection`.
+
+  * Add `Generically` and `Generically1` to `GHC.Generics` for deriving generic
+    instances with `DerivingVia`. `Generically` instances include `Semigroup` and
+    `Monoid`. `Generically1` instances: `Functor`, `Applicative`, `Alternative`,
+    `Eq1` and `Ord1`.
+
+  * Introduce `GHC.ExecutablePath.executablePath`, which is more robust than
+    `getExecutablePath` in cases when the executable has been deleted.
+
+  * Add `Data.Array.Byte` module, providing boxed `ByteArray#` and `MutableByteArray#` wrappers.
+
+  * `fromEnum` for `Natural` now throws an error for any number that cannot be
+    repesented exactly by an `Int` (#20291).
+
+  * `returnA` is defined as `Control.Category.id` instead of `arr id`.
+
+  * Added symbolic synonyms for `xor` and shift operators to `Data.Bits`:
+
+    - `.^.` (`xor`),
+    - `.>>.` and `!>>.` (`shiftR` and `unsafeShiftR`),
+    - `.<<.` and `!<<.` (`shiftL` and `unsafeShiftL`).
+
+    These new operators have the same fixity as the originals.
+
+  * `GHC.Exts` now re-exports `Multiplicity` and `MultMul`.
+
+  * A large number of partial functions in `Data.List` and `Data.List.NonEmpty` now
+    have an HasCallStack constraint. Hopefully providing better error messages in case
+    they are used in unexpected ways.
+
+  * Fix the `Ord1` instance for `Data.Ord.Down` to reverse sort order.
+
+  * Any Haskell type that wraps a C pointer type has been changed from
+    `Ptr ()` to `CUIntPtr`. For typical glibc based platforms, the
+    affected type is `CTimer`.
+
+  * Remove instances of `MonadFail` for the `ST` monad (lazy and strict) as per
+    the [Core Libraries proposal](https://github.com/haskell/core-libraries-committee/issues/33).
+    A [migration guide](https://github.com/haskell/core-libraries-committee/blob/main/guides/no-monadfail-st-inst.md)
+    is available.
+
+  * Re-export `augment` and `build` function from `GHC.List`
+
+  * Re-export the `IsList` typeclass from the new `GHC.IsList` module.
+
+  * There's a new special function ``withDict`` in ``GHC.Exts``: ::
+
+        withDict :: forall {rr :: RuntimeRep} cls meth (r :: TYPE rr). WithDict cls meth => meth -> (cls => r) -> r
+
+    where ``cls`` must be a class containing exactly one method, whose type
+    must be ``meth``.
+
+    This function converts ``meth`` to a type class dictionary.
+    It removes the need for ``unsafeCoerce`` in implementation of reflection
+    libraries. It should be used with care, because it can introduce
+    incoherent instances.
+
+    For example, the ``withTypeable`` function from the
+    ``Type.Reflection`` module can now be defined as: ::
+
+          withTypeable :: forall k (a :: k) rep (r :: TYPE rep). ()
+                       => TypeRep a -> (Typeable a => r) -> r
+          withTypeable rep k = withDict @(Typeable a) rep k
+
+    Note that the explicit type application is required, as the call to
+    ``withDict`` would be ambiguous otherwise.
+
+    This replaces the old ``GHC.Exts.magicDict``, which required
+    an intermediate data type and was less reliable.
+
+  * `Data.Word.Word64` and `Data.Int.Int64` are now always represented by
+    `Word64#` and `Int64#`, respectively. Previously on 32-bit platforms these
+    were rather represented by `Word#` and `Int#`. See GHC #11953.
+
+  * Add `GHC.TypeError` module to contain functionality related to custom type
+    errors. `TypeError` is re-exported from `GHC.TypeLits` for backwards
+    compatibility.
+
+  * Comparison constraints in `Data.Type.Ord` (e.g. `<=`) now use the new
+    `GHC.TypeError.Assert` type family instead of type equality with `~`.
+

+## 4.16.0.0 *Nov 2021*
+
+  * Shipped with GHC 9.2.1
+
+  * The unary tuple type, `Solo`, is now exported by `Data.Tuple`.
+
+  * Add a `Typeable` constraint to `fromStaticPtr` in the class `GHC.StaticPtr.IsStatic`.
+
+  * Make it possible to promote `Natural`s and remove the separate `Nat` kind.
+    For backwards compatibility, `Nat` is now a type synonym for `Natural`.
+    As a consequence, one must enable `TypeSynonymInstances`
+    in order to define instances for `Nat`. Also, different instances for `Nat` and `Natural`
+    won't typecheck anymore.
+
+  * Add `Data.Type.Ord` as a module for type-level comparison operations.  The
+    `(<=?)` type operator from `GHC.TypeNats`, previously kind-specific to
+    `Nat`, is now kind-polymorphic and governed by the `Compare` type family in
+    `Data.Type.Ord`.  Note that this means GHC will no longer deduce `0 <= n`
+    for all `n` any more.
+
+  * Add `cmpNat`, `cmpSymbol`, and `cmpChar` to `GHC.TypeNats` and `GHC.TypeLits`.
+
+  * Add `CmpChar`, `ConsSymbol`, `UnconsSymbol`, `CharToNat`, and `NatToChar`
+    type families to `GHC.TypeLits`.
+
+  * Add the `KnownChar` class, `charVal` and `charVal'` to `GHC.TypeLits`.
+
+  * Add `Semigroup` and `Monoid` instances for `Data.Functor.Product` and
+    `Data.Functor.Compose`.
+
+  * Add `Functor`, `Applicative`, `Monad`, `MonadFix`, `Foldable`, `Traversable`,
+    `Eq`, `Ord`, `Show`, `Read`, `Eq1`, `Ord1`, `Show1`, `Read1`, `Generic`,
+    `Generic1`, and `Data` instances for `GHC.Tuple.Solo`.
+
+  * Add `Eq1`, `Read1` and `Show1` instances for `Complex`;
+    add `Eq1/2`, `Ord1/2`, `Show1/2` and `Read1/2` instances for 3 and 4-tuples.
+
+  * Remove `Data.Semigroup.Option` and the accompanying `option` function.
+
+  * Make `allocaBytesAligned` and `alloca` throw an IOError when the
+    alignment is not a power-of-two. The underlying primop
+    `newAlignedPinnedByteArray#` actually always assumed this but we didn't
+    document this fact in the user facing API until now.
+
+    `Generic1`, and `Data` instances for `GHC.Tuple.Solo`.
+
+  * Under POSIX, `System.IO.openFile` will no longer leak a file descriptor if it
+    is interrupted by an asynchronous exception (#19114, #19115).
+
+  * Additionally export `asum` from `Control.Applicative`
+
+  * `fromInteger :: Integer -> Float/Double` now consistently round to the
+    nearest value, with ties to even.
+
+  * Additions to `Data.Bits`:
+
+    - Newtypes `And`, `Ior`, `Xor` and `Iff` which wrap their argument,
+      and whose `Semigroup` instances are defined using `(.&.)`, `(.|.)`, `xor`
+      and ```\x y -> complement (x `xor` y)```, respectively.
+
+    - `oneBits :: FiniteBits a => a`, `oneBits = complement zeroBits`.
+
+## 4.15.0.0 *Feb 2021*
+
+  * Shipped with GHC 9.0.1
+
+  * `openFile` now calls the `open` system call with an `interruptible` FFI
+    call, ensuring that the call can be interrupted with `SIGINT` on POSIX
+    systems.
+
+  * Make `openFile` more tolerant of asynchronous exceptions: more care taken
+    to release the file descriptor and the read/write lock (#18832)
+
+  * Add `hGetContents'`, `getContents'`, and `readFile'` in `System.IO`:
+    Strict IO variants of `hGetContents`, `getContents`, and `readFile`.
+
+  * Add `singleton` function for `Data.List.NonEmpty`.
+
+  * The planned deprecation of `Data.Monoid.First` and `Data.Monoid.Last`
+    is scrapped due to difficulties with the suggested migration path.
+
+  * `Data.Semigroup.Option` and the accompanying `option` function are
+    deprecated and scheduled for removal in 4.16.
+
+  * Add `Generic` instances to `Fingerprint`, `GiveGCStats`, `GCFlags`,
+    `ConcFlags`, `DebugFlags`, `CCFlags`, `DoHeapProfile`, `ProfFlags`,
+    `DoTrace`, `TraceFlags`, `TickyFlags`, `ParFlags`, `RTSFlags`, `RTSStats`,
+    `GCStats`, `ByteOrder`, `GeneralCategory`, `SrcLoc`
+
+  * Add rules `unpackUtf8`, `unpack-listUtf8` and `unpack-appendUtf8` to `GHC.Base`.
+    They correspond to their ascii versions and hopefully make it easier
+    for libraries to handle utf8 encoded strings efficiently.
+
+  * An issue with list fusion and `elem` was fixed. `elem` applied to known
+    small lists will now compile to a simple case statement more often.
+
+  * Add `MonadFix` and `MonadZip` instances for `Complex`
+
+  * Add `Ix` instances for tuples of size 6 through 15
+
+  * Correct `Bounded` instance and remove `Enum` and `Integral` instances for
+    `Data.Ord.Down`.
+
+  * `catMaybes` is now implemented using `mapMaybe`, so that it is both a "good
+    consumer" and "good producer" for list-fusion (#18574)
+
+  * `Foreign.ForeignPtr.withForeignPtr` is now less aggressively optimised,
+    avoiding the soundness issue reported in
+    [#17760](https://gitlab.haskell.org/ghc/ghc/-/issues/17760) in exchange for
+    a small amount more allocation. If your application regresses significantly
+    *and* the continuation given to `withForeignPtr` will *not* provably
+    diverge then the previous optimisation behavior can be recovered by instead
+    using `GHC.ForeignPtr.unsafeWithForeignPtr`.
+
+  * Correct `Bounded` instance and remove `Enum` and `Integral` instances for
+    `Data.Ord.Down`.
+
+  * `Data.Foldable` methods `maximum{,By}`, `minimum{,By}`, `product` and `sum`
+    are now stricter by default, as well as in the class implementation for List.
+

+## 4.13.0.0 *July 2019*
+  * Bundled with GHC 8.8.1
+
+  * The final phase of the `MonadFail` proposal has been implemented:
+
+    * The `fail` method of `Monad` has been removed in favor of the method of
+      the same name in the `MonadFail` class.
+
+    * `MonadFail(fail)` is now re-exported from the `Prelude` and
+      `Control.Monad` modules.
+
+  * Fix `Show` instance of `Data.Fixed`: Negative numbers are now parenthesized
+    according to their surrounding context. I.e. `Data.Fixed.show` produces
+    syntactically correct Haskell for expressions like `Just (-1 :: Fixed E2)`.
+    (#16031)
+
+  * Support the characters from recent versions of Unicode (up to v. 12) in
+    literals (#5518).
+
+  * The `StableName` type parameter now has a phantom role instead of
+    a representational one. There is really no reason to care about the
+    type of the underlying object.
+
+  * Add `foldMap'`, a strict version of `foldMap`, to `Foldable`.
+
+  * The `shiftL` and `shiftR` methods in the `Bits` instances of `Int`, `IntN`,
+    `Word`, and `WordN` now throw an overflow exception for negative shift
+    values (instead of being undefined behaviour).
+
+  * `scanr` no longer crashes when passed a fusable, infinite list. (#16943)
+
+## 4.12.0.0 *21 September 2018*
+  * Bundled with GHC 8.6.1
+
+  * The STM invariant-checking mechanism (`always` and `alwaysSucceeds`), which
+    was deprecated in GHC 8.4, has been removed (as proposed in
+    <https://github.com/ghc-proposals/ghc-proposals/blob/master/proposals/0011-deprecate-stm-invariants.rst>).
+    This is a bit earlier than proposed in the deprecation pragma included in
+    GHC 8.4, but due to community feedback we decided to move ahead with the
+    early removal.
+
+    Existing users are encouraged to encapsulate their STM operations in safe
+    abstractions which can perform the invariant checking without help from the
+    runtime system.
+
+  * Add a new module `GHC.ResponseFile` (previously defined in the `haddock`
+    package). (#13896)
+
+  * Move the module `Data.Functor.Contravariant` from the
+    `contravariant` package to `base`.
+
+  * `($!)` is now representation-polymorphic like `($)`.
+
+  * Add `Applicative` (for `K1`), `Semigroup` and `Monoid` instances in
+    `GHC.Generics`. (#14849)
+
+  * `asinh` for `Float` and `Double` is now numerically stable in the face of
+    non-small negative arguments and enormous arguments of either sign. (#14927)
+
+  * `Numeric.showEFloat (Just 0)` now respects the user's requested precision.
+    (#15115)
+
+  * `Data.Monoid.Alt` now has `Foldable` and `Traversable` instances. (#15099)
+
+  * `Data.Monoid.Ap` has been introduced
+
+  * `Control.Exception.throw` is now levity polymorphic. (#15180)
+
+  * `Data.Ord.Down` now has a number of new instances. These include:
+    `MonadFix`, `MonadZip`, `Data`, `Foldable`, `Traversable`, `Eq1`, `Ord1`,
+    `Read1`, `Show1`, `Generic`, `Generic1`. (#15098)
+
+

+## 4.11.0.0 *8 March 2018*
+  * Bundled with GHC 8.4.1
+
+  * `System.IO.openTempFile` is now thread-safe on Windows.
+
+  * Deprecated `GHC.Stats.GCStats` interface has been removed.
+
+  * Add `showHFloat` to `Numeric`
+
+  * Add `Div`, `Mod`, and `Log2` functions on type-level naturals
+    in `GHC.TypeLits`.
+
+  * Add `Alternative` instance for `ZipList` (#13520)
+
+  * Add instances `Num`, `Functor`, `Applicative`, `Monad`, `Semigroup`
+    and `Monoid` for `Data.Ord.Down` (#13097).
+
+  * Add `Semigroup` instance for `EventLifetime`.
+
+  * Make `Semigroup` a superclass of `Monoid`;
+    export `Semigroup((<>))` from `Prelude`; remove `Monoid` reexport
+    from `Data.Semigroup` (#14191).
+
+  * Generalise `instance Monoid a => Monoid (Maybe a)` to
+    `instance Semigroup a => Monoid (Maybe a)`.
+
+  * Add `infixl 9 !!` declaration for `Data.List.NonEmpty.!!`
+
+  * Add `<&>` operator to `Data.Functor` (#14029)
+
+  * Remove the deprecated `Typeable{1..7}` type synonyms (#14047)
+
+  * Make `Data.Type.Equality.==` a closed type family. It now works for all
+  kinds out of the box. Any modules that previously declared instances of this
+  family will need to remove them. Whereas the previous definition was somewhat
+  ad hoc, the behavior is now completely uniform. As a result, some applications
+  that used to reduce no longer do, and conversely. Most notably, `(==)` no
+  longer treats the `*`, `j -> k`, or `()` kinds specially; equality is
+  tested structurally in all cases.
+
+  * Add instances `Semigroup` and `Monoid` for `Control.Monad.ST` (#14107).
+
+  * The `Read` instances for `Proxy`, `Coercion`, `(:~:)`, `(:~~:)`, and `U1`
+    now ignore the parsing precedence. The effect of this is that `read` will
+    be able to successfully parse more strings containing `"Proxy"` _et al._
+    without surrounding parentheses (e.g., `"Thing Proxy"`) (#12874).
+
+  * Add `iterate'`, a strict version of `iterate`, to `Data.List`
+    and `Data.OldList` (#3474)
+
+  * Add `Data` instances for `IntPtr` and `WordPtr` (#13115)
+
+  * Add missing `MonadFail` instance for `Control.Monad.Strict.ST.ST`
+
+  * Make `zipWith` and `zipWith3` inlinable (#14224)
+
+  * `Type.Reflection.App` now matches on function types (fixes #14236)
+
+  * `Type.Reflection.withTypeable` is now polymorphic in the `RuntimeRep` of
+    its result.
+
+  * Add `installSEHHandlers` to `MiscFlags` in `GHC.RTS.Flags` to determine if
+    exception handling is enabled.
+
+  * The deprecated functions `isEmptyChan` and `unGetChan` in
+    `Control.Concurrent.Chan` have been removed (#13561).
+
+  * Add `generateCrashDumpFile` to `MiscFlags` in `GHC.RTS.Flags` to determine
+    if a core dump will be generated on crashes.
+
+  * Add `generateStackTrace` to `MiscFlags` in `GHC.RTS.Flags` to determine if
+    stack traces will be generated on unhandled exceptions by the RTS.
+
+  * `getExecutablePath` now resolves symlinks on Windows (#14483)
+
+  * Deprecated STM invariant checking primitives (`checkInv`, `always`, and
+    `alwaysSucceeds`) in `GHC.Conc.Sync` (#14324).
+
+  * Add a `FixIOException` data type to `Control.Exception.Base`, and change
+    `fixIO` to throw that instead of a `BlockedIndefinitelyOnMVar` exception
+    (#14356).
+

+## 4.10.0.0 *July 2017*
+  * Bundled with GHC 8.2.1
+
+  * `Data.Type.Bool.Not` given a type family dependency (#12057).
+
+  * `Foreign.Ptr` now exports the constructors for `IntPtr` and `WordPtr`
+    (#11983)
+
+  * `Generic1`, as well as the associated datatypes and typeclasses in
+    `GHC.Generics`, are now poly-kinded (#10604)
+
+  * `New modules `Data.Bifoldable` and `Data.Bitraversable` (previously defined
+    in the `bifunctors` package) (#10448)
+
+  * `Data.Either` now provides `fromLeft` and `fromRight` (#12402)
+
+  * `Data.Type.Coercion` now provides `gcoerceWith` (#12493)
+
+  * New methods `liftReadList(2)` and `liftReadListPrec(2)` in the
+    `Read1`/`Read2` classes that are defined in terms of `ReadPrec` instead of
+    `ReadS`, as well as related combinators, have been added to
+    `Data.Functor.Classes` (#12358)
+
+  * Add `Semigroup` instance for `IO`, as well as for `Event` and `Lifetime`
+    from `GHC.Event` (#12464)
+
+  * Add `Data` instance for `Const` (#12438)
+
+  * Added `Eq1`, `Ord1`, `Read1` and `Show1` instances for `NonEmpty`.
+
+  * Add wrappers for `blksize_t`, `blkcnt_t`, `clockid_t`, `fsblkcnt_t`,
+    `fsfilcnt_t`, `id_t`, `key_t`, and `timer_t` to System.Posix.Types (#12795)
+
+  * Add `CBool`, a wrapper around C's `bool` type, to `Foreign.C.Types`
+    (#13136)
+
+  * Raw buffer operations in `GHC.IO.FD` are now strict in the buffer, offset, and length operations (#9696)
+
+  * Add `plusForeignPtr` to `Foreign.ForeignPtr`.
+
+  * Add `type family AppendSymbol (m :: Symbol) (n :: Symbol) :: Symbol` to `GHC.TypeLits`
+    (#12162)
+
+  * Add `GHC.TypeNats` module with `Natural`-based `KnownNat`. The `Nat`
+    operations in `GHC.TypeLits` are a thin compatibility layer on top.
+    Note: the `KnownNat` evidence is changed from an `Integer` to a `Natural`.
+
+  * The type of `asProxyTypeOf` in `Data.Proxy` has been generalized (#12805)
+
+  * `liftA2` is now a method of the `Applicative` class. `liftA2` and
+    `<*>` each have a default implementation based on the other. Various
+    library functions have been updated to use `liftA2` where it might offer
+    some benefit. `liftA2` is not yet in the `Prelude`, and must currently be
+    imported from `Control.Applicative`. It is likely to be added to the
+    `Prelude` in the future. (#13191)
+
+  * A new module, `Type.Reflection`, exposing GHC's new type-indexed type
+    representation mechanism is now provided.
+
+  * `Data.Dynamic` now exports the `Dyn` data constructor, enabled by the new
+    type-indexed type representation mechanism.
+
+  * `Data.Type.Equality` now provides a kind heterogeneous type equality
+    evidence type, `(:~~:)`.
+
+  * The `CostCentresXML` constructor of `GHC.RTS.Flags.DoCostCentres` has been
+    replaced by `CostCentresJSON` due to the new JSON export format supported by
+    the cost centre profiler.
+
+  * The `ErrorCall` pattern synonym has been given a `COMPLETE` pragma so that
+    functions which solely match again `ErrorCall` do not produce
+    non-exhaustive pattern-match warnings (#8779)
+
+  * Change the implementations of `maximumBy` and `minimumBy` from
+    `Data.Foldable` to use `foldl1` instead of `foldr1`. This makes them run
+    in constant space when applied to lists. (#10830)
+
+  * `mkFunTy`, `mkAppTy`, and `mkTyConApp` from `Data.Typeable` no longer exist.
+    This functionality is superceded by the interfaces provided by
+    `Type.Reflection`.
+
+  * `mkTyCon3` is no longer exported by `Data.Typeable`. This function is
+    replaced by `Type.Reflection.Unsafe.mkTyCon`.
+
+  * `Data.List.NonEmpty.unfold` has been deprecated in favor of `unfoldr`,
+    which is functionally equivalent.
+
+## 4.9.0.0  *May 2016*
+
+  * Bundled with GHC 8.0
+
+  * `error` and `undefined` now print a partial stack-trace alongside the error message.
+
+  * New `errorWithoutStackTrace` function throws an error without printing the stack trace.
+
+  * The restore operation provided by `mask` and `uninterruptibleMask` now
+    restores the previous masking state whatever the current masking state is.
+
+  * New `GHC.Generics.packageName` operation
+
+  * Redesigned `GHC.Stack.CallStack` data type. As a result, `CallStack`'s
+    `Show` instance produces different output, and `CallStack` no longer has an
+    `Eq` instance.
+
+  * New `GHC.Generics.packageName` operation
+
+  * New `GHC.Stack.Types` module now contains the definition of
+    `CallStack` and `SrcLoc`
+
+  * New `GHC.Stack.Types.emptyCallStack` function builds an empty `CallStack`
+
+  * New `GHC.Stack.Types.freezeCallStack` function freezes a `CallStack` preventing future `pushCallStack` operations from having any effect
+
+  * New `GHC.Stack.Types.pushCallStack` function pushes a call-site onto a `CallStack`
+
+  * New `GHC.Stack.Types.fromCallSiteList` function creates a `CallStack` from
+    a list of call-sites (i.e., `[(String, SrcLoc)]`)
+
+  * `GHC.SrcLoc` has been removed
+
+  * `GHC.Stack.showCallStack` and `GHC.SrcLoc.showSrcLoc` are now called
+    `GHC.Stack.prettyCallStack` and `GHC.Stack.prettySrcLoc` respectively
+
+  * add `Data.List.NonEmpty` and `Data.Semigroup` (to become
+    super-class of `Monoid` in the future). These modules were
+    provided by the `semigroups` package previously. (#10365)
+
+  * Add `selSourceUnpackedness`, `selSourceStrictness`, and
+    `selDecidedStrictness`, three functions which look up strictness
+    information of a field in a data constructor, to the `Selector` type class
+    in `GHC.Generics` (#10716)
+
+  * Add `URec`, `UAddr`, `UChar`, `UDouble`, `UFloat`, `UInt`, and `UWord` to
+    `GHC.Generics` as part of making GHC generics capable of handling
+    unlifted types (#10868)
+
+  * The `Eq`, `Ord`, `Read`, and `Show` instances for `U1` now use lazier
+    pattern-matching
+
+  * Keep `shift{L,R}` on `Integer` with negative shift-arguments from
+    segfaulting (#10571)
+
+  * Add `forkOSWithUnmask` to `Control.Concurrent`, which is like
+    `forkIOWithUnmask`, but the child is run in a bound thread.
+
+  * The `MINIMAL` definition of `Arrow` is now `arr AND (first OR (***))`.
+
+  * The `MINIMAL` definition of `ArrowChoice` is now `left OR (+++)`.
+
+  * Exported `GiveGCStats`, `DoCostCentres`, `DoHeapProfile`, `DoTrace`,
+    `RtsTime`, and `RtsNat` from `GHC.RTS.Flags`
+
+  * New function `GHC.IO.interruptible` used to correctly implement
+    `Control.Exception.allowInterrupt` (#9516)
+
+  * Made `PatternMatchFail`, `RecSelError`, `RecConError`, `RecUpdError`,
+    `NoMethodError`, and `AssertionFailed` newtypes (#10738)
+
+  * New module `Control.Monad.IO.Class` (previously provided by `transformers`
+    package). (#10773)
+
+  * New modules `Data.Functor.Classes`, `Data.Functor.Compose`,
+    `Data.Functor.Product`, and `Data.Functor.Sum` (previously provided by
+    `transformers` package). (#11135)
+
+  * New instances for `Proxy`: `Eq1`, `Ord1`, `Show1`, `Read1`. All
+    of the classes are from `Data.Functor.Classes` (#11756).
+
+  * New module `Control.Monad.Fail` providing new `MonadFail(fail)`
+    class (#10751)
+
+  * Add `GHC.TypeLits.TypeError` and `ErrorMessage` to allow users
+    to define custom compile-time error messages.
+
+  * Redesign `GHC.Generics` to use type-level literals to represent the
+    metadata of generic representation types (#9766)
+
+  * The `IsString` instance for `[Char]` has been modified to eliminate
+    ambiguity arising from overloaded strings and functions like `(++)`.
+
+  * Move `Const` from `Control.Applicative` to its own module in
+   `Data.Functor.Const`. (#11135)
+
+  * Re-export `Const` from `Control.Applicative` for backwards compatibility.
+
+  * Expand `Floating` class to include operations that allow for better
+    precision: `log1p`, `expm1`, `log1pexp` and `log1mexp`. These are not
+    available from `Prelude`, but the full class is exported from `Numeric`.
+
+  * New `Control.Exception.TypeError` datatype, which is thrown when an
+    expression fails to typecheck when run using `-fdefer-type-errors` (#10284)
+
+  * The `bitSize` method of `Data.Bits.Bits` now has a (partial!)
+    default implementation based on `bitSizeMaybe`. (#12970)
+
+### New instances
+
+  * `Alt`, `Dual`, `First`, `Last`, `Product`, and `Sum` now have `Data`,
+    `MonadZip`, and `MonadFix` instances
+
+  * The datatypes in `GHC.Generics` now have `Enum`, `Bounded`, `Ix`,
+    `Functor`, `Applicative`, `Monad`, `MonadFix`, `MonadPlus`, `MonadZip`,
+    `Foldable`, `Foldable`, `Traversable`, `Generic1`, and `Data` instances
+    as appropriate.
+
+  * `Maybe` now has a `MonadZip` instance
+
+  * `All` and `Any` now have `Data` instances
+
+  * `Dual`, `First`, `Last`, `Product`, and `Sum` now have `Foldable` and
+    `Traversable` instances
+
+  * `Dual`, `Product`, and `Sum` now have `Functor`, `Applicative`, and
+    `Monad` instances
+
+  * `(,) a` now has a `Monad` instance
+
+  * `ZipList` now has `Foldable` and `Traversable` instances
+
+  * `Identity` now has `Semigroup` and `Monoid` instances
+
+  * `Identity` and `Const` now have `Bits`, `Bounded`, `Enum`, `FiniteBits`,
+    `Floating`, `Fractional`, `Integral`, `IsString`, `Ix`, `Num`, `Real`,
+    `RealFloat`, `RealFrac` and `Storable` instances. (#11210, #11790)
+
+  * `()` now has a `Storable` instance
+
+  * `Complex` now has `Generic`, `Generic1`, `Functor`, `Foldable`, `Traversable`,
+    `Applicative`, and `Monad` instances
+
+  * `System.Exit.ExitCode` now has a `Generic` instance
+
+  * `Data.Version.Version` now has a `Generic` instance
+
+  * `IO` now has a `Monoid` instance
+
+  * Add `MonadPlus IO` and `Alternative IO` instances
+    (previously orphans in `transformers`) (#10755)
+
+  * `CallStack` now has an `IsList` instance
+
+  * The field `spInfoName` of `GHC.StaticPtr.StaticPtrInfo` has been removed.
+    The value is no longer available when constructing the `StaticPtr`.
+
+  * `VecElem` and `VecCount` now have `Enum` and `Bounded` instances.
+
+### Generalizations
+
+  * Generalize `Debug.Trace.{traceM, traceShowM}` from `Monad` to `Applicative`
+    (#10023)
+
+  * Redundant typeclass constraints have been removed:
+     - `Data.Ratio.{denominator,numerator}` have no `Integral` constraint anymore
+     - **TODO**
+
+  * Generalise `forever` from `Monad` to `Applicative`
+
+  * Generalize `filterM`, `mapAndUnzipM`, `zipWithM`, `zipWithM_`, `replicateM`,
+    `replicateM_` from `Monad` to `Applicative` (#10168)
+
+  * The `Generic` instance for `Proxy` is now poly-kinded (#10775)
+
+  * Enable `PolyKinds` in the `Data.Functor.Const` module to give `Const`
+    the kind `* -> k -> *`. (#10039)
+

+## 4.8.0.0  *Mar 2015*
+
+  * Bundled with GHC 7.10.1
+
+  * Make `Applicative` a superclass of `Monad`
+
+  * Add reverse application operator `Data.Function.(&)`
+
+  * Add `Data.List.sortOn` sorting function
+
+  * Add `System.Exit.die`
+
+  * Deprecate `versionTags` field of `Data.Version.Version`.
+    Add `makeVersion :: [Int] -> Version` constructor function to aid
+    migration to a future `versionTags`-less `Version`.
+
+  * Add `IsList Version` instance
+
+  * Weaken RealFloat constraints on some `Data.Complex` functions
+
+  * Add `Control.Monad.(<$!>)` as a strict version of `(<$>)`
+
+  * The `Data.Monoid` module now has the `PolyKinds` extension
+    enabled, so that the `Monoid` instance for `Proxy` are polykinded
+    like `Proxy` itself is.
+
+  * Make `abs` and `signum` handle (-0.0) correctly per IEEE-754.
+
+  * Re-export `Data.Word.Word` from `Prelude`
+
+  * Add `countLeadingZeros` and `countTrailingZeros` methods to
+    `Data.Bits.FiniteBits` class
+
+  * Add `Data.List.uncons` list destructor (#9550)
+
+  * Export `Monoid(..)` from `Prelude`
+
+  * Export `Foldable(..)` from `Prelude`
+    (hiding `fold`, `foldl'`, `foldr'`, and `toList`)
+
+  * Export `Traversable(..)` from `Prelude`
+
+  * Set fixity for `Data.Foldable.{elem,notElem}` to match the
+    conventional one set for `Data.List.{elem,notElem}` (#9610)
+
+  * Turn `toList`, `elem`, `sum`, `product`, `maximum`, and `minimum`
+    into `Foldable` methods (#9621)
+
+  * Replace the `Data.List`-exported functions
+
+    ```
+    all, and, any, concat, concatMap, elem, find, product, sum,
+    mapAccumL, mapAccumR
+    ```
+
+    by re-exports of their generalised `Data.Foldable`/`Data.Traversable`
+    counterparts.  In other words, unqualified imports of `Data.List`
+    and `Data.Foldable`/`Data.Traversable` no longer lead to conflicting
+    definitions. (#9586)
+
+  * New (unofficial) module `GHC.OldList` containing only list-specialised
+    versions of the functions from `Data.List` (in other words, `GHC.OldList`
+    corresponds to `base-4.7.0.2`'s `Data.List`)
+
+  * Replace the `Control.Monad`-exported functions
+
+    ```
+    sequence_, msum, mapM_, forM_,
+    forM, mapM, sequence
+    ```
+
+    by re-exports of their generalised `Data.Foldable`/`Data.Traversable`
+    counterparts.  In other words, unqualified imports of `Control.Monad`
+    and `Data.Foldable`/`Data.Traversable` no longer lead to conflicting
+    definitions. (#9586)
+
+  * Generalise `Control.Monad.{when,unless,guard}` from `Monad` to
+    `Applicative` and from `MonadPlus` to `Alternative` respectively.
+
+  * Generalise `Control.Monad.{foldM,foldM_}` to `Foldable`
+
+  * `scanr`, `mapAccumL` and `filterM` now take part in list fusion (#9355,
+    #9502, #9546)
+
+  * Remove deprecated `Data.OldTypeable` (#9639)
+
+  * New module `Data.Bifunctor` providing the `Bifunctor(bimap,first,second)`
+    class (previously defined in `bifunctors` package) (#9682)
+
+  * New module `Data.Void` providing the canonical uninhabited type `Void`
+    (previously defined in `void` package) (#9814)
+
+  * Update Unicode class definitions to Unicode version 7.0
+
+  * Add `Alt`, an `Alternative` wrapper, to `Data.Monoid`. (#9759)
+
+  * Add `isSubsequenceOf` to `Data.List` (#9767)
+
+  * The arguments to `==` and `eq` in `Data.List.nub` and `Data.List.nubBy`
+    are swapped, such that `Data.List.nubBy (<) [1,2]` now returns `[1]`
+    instead of `[1,2]` (#2528, #3280, #7913)
+
+  * New module `Data.Functor.Identity` (previously provided by `transformers`
+    package). (#9664)
+
+  * Add `scanl'`, a strictly accumulating version of `scanl`, to `Data.List`
+    and `Data.OldList`. (#9368)
+
+  * Add `fillBytes` to `Foreign.Marshal.Utils`.
+
+  * Add new `displayException` method to `Exception` typeclass. (#9822)
+
+  * Add `Data.Bits.toIntegralSized`, a size-checked version of
+    `fromIntegral`. (#9816)
+
+  * New module `Numeric.Natural` providing new `Natural` type
+    representing non-negative arbitrary-precision integers.  The `GHC.Natural`
+    module exposes additional GHC-specific primitives. (#9818)
+
+  * Add `(Storable a, Integeral a) => Storable (Ratio a)` instance (#9826)
+
+  * Add `Storable a => Storable (Complex a)` instance (#9826)
+
+  * New module `GHC.RTS.Flags` that provides accessors to runtime flags.
+
+  * Expose functions for per-thread allocation counters and limits in `GHC.Conc`
+
+        disableAllocationLimit :: IO ()
+        enableAllocationLimit :: IO ()
+        getAllocationCounter :: IO Int64
+        setAllocationCounter :: Int64 -> IO ()
+
+    together with a new exception `AllocationLimitExceeded`.
+
+  * Make `read . show = id` for `Data.Fixed` (#9240)
+
+  * Add `calloc` and `callocBytes` to `Foreign.Marshal.Alloc`. (#9859)
+
+  * Add `callocArray` and `callocArray0` to `Foreign.Marshal.Array`. (#9859)
+
+  * Restore invariant in `Data (Ratio a)` instance (#10011)
+
+  * Add/expose `rnfTypeRep`, `rnfTyCon`, `typeRepFingerprint`, and
+    `tyConFingerprint` helpers to `Data.Typeable`.
+
+  * Define proper `MINIMAL` pragma for `class Ix`. (#10142)
+

+## 4.7.0.0  *Apr 2014*
+
+  * Bundled with GHC 7.8.1
+
+  * Add `/Since: 4.[4567].0.0/` Haddock annotations to entities
+    denoting the package version, when the given entity was introduced
+    (or its type signature changed in a non-compatible way)
+
+  * The `Control.Category` module now has the `PolyKinds` extension
+    enabled, meaning that instances of `Category` no longer need be of
+    kind `* -> * -> *`.
+
+  * There are now `Foldable` and `Traversable` instances for `Either a`,
+   `Const r`, and `(,) a`.
+
+  * There are now `Show`, `Read`, `Eq`, `Ord`, `Monoid`, `Generic`, and
+    `Generic1` instances for `Const`.
+
+  * There is now a `Data` instance for `Data.Version`.
+
+  * A new `Data.Bits.FiniteBits` class has been added to represent
+    types with fixed bit-count. The existing `Bits` class is extended
+    with a `bitSizeMaybe` method to replace the now obsolete
+    `bitsize` method.
+
+  * `Data.Bits.Bits` gained a new `zeroBits` method which completes the
+    `Bits` API with a direct way to introduce a value with all bits cleared.
+
+  * There are now `Bits` and `FiniteBits` instances for `Bool`.
+
+  * There are now `Eq`, `Ord`, `Show`, `Read`, `Generic`. and `Generic1`
+    instances for `ZipList`.
+
+  * There are now `Eq`, `Ord`, `Show` and `Read` instances for `Down`.
+
+  * There are now `Eq`, `Ord`, `Show`, `Read` and `Generic` instances
+    for types in GHC.Generics (`U1`, `Par1`, `Rec1`, `K1`, `M1`,
+    `(:+:)`, `(:*:)`, `(:.:)`).
+
+  * `Data.Monoid`: There are now `Generic` instances for `Dual`, `Endo`,
+    `All`, `Any`, `Sum`, `Product`, `First`, and `Last`; as well as
+    `Generic1` instances for `Dual`, `Sum`, `Product`, `First`, and `Last`.
+
+  * The `Data.Monoid.{Product,Sum}` newtype wrappers now have `Num` instances.
+
+  * There are now `Functor` instances for `System.Console.GetOpt`'s
+    `ArgOrder`, `OptDescr`, and `ArgDescr`.
+
+  * A zero-width unboxed poly-kinded `Proxy#` was added to
+    `GHC.Prim`. It can be used to make it so that there is no the
+    operational overhead for passing around proxy arguments to model
+    type application.
+
+  * New `Data.Proxy` module providing a concrete, poly-kinded proxy type.
+
+  * New `Data.Coerce` module which exports the new `Coercible` class
+    together with the `coerce` primitive which provide safe coercion
+    (wrt role checking) between types with same representation.
+
+  * `Control.Concurrent.MVar` has a new implementation of `readMVar`,
+    which fixes a long-standing bug where `readMVar` is only atomic if
+    there are no other threads running `putMVar`.  `readMVar` now is
+    atomic, and is guaranteed to return the value from the first
+    `putMVar`.  There is also a new `tryReadMVar` which is a
+    non-blocking version.
+
+  * New `Control.Concurrent.MVar.withMVarMasked` which executes
+    `IO` action with asynchronous exceptions masked in the same style
+    as the existing `modifyMVarMasked` and `modifyMVarMasked_`.
+
+  * New `threadWait{Read,Write}STM :: Fd -> IO (STM (), IO ())`
+    functions added to `Control.Concurrent` for waiting on FD
+    readiness with STM actions.
+
+  * Expose `Data.Fixed.Fixed`'s constructor.
+
+  * There are now byte endian-swapping primitives
+    `byteSwap{16,32,64}` available in `Data.Word`, which use
+    optimized machine instructions when available.
+
+  * `Data.Bool` now exports `bool :: a -> a -> Bool -> a`, analogously
+    to `maybe` and `either` in their respective modules.
+
+  * `Data.Either` now exports `isLeft, isRight :: Either a b -> Bool`.
+
+  * `Debug.Trace` now exports `traceId`, `traceShowId`, `traceM`,
+    and `traceShowM`.
+
+  * `Data.Functor` now exports `($>)` and `void`.
+
+  * Rewrote portions of `Text.Printf`, and made changes to `Numeric`
+    (added `Numeric.showFFloatAlt` and `Numeric.showGFloatAlt`) and
+    `GHC.Float` (added `formatRealFloatAlt`) to support it.  The
+    rewritten version is extensible to user types, adds a "generic"
+    format specifier "`%v`", extends the `printf` spec to support much
+    of C's `printf(3)` functionality, and fixes the spurious warnings
+    about using `Text.Printf.printf` at `(IO a)` while ignoring the
+    return value.  These changes were contributed by Bart Massey.
+
+  * The minimal complete definitions for all type-classes with cyclic
+    default implementations have been explicitly annotated with the
+    new `{-# MINIMAL #-}` pragma.
+
+  * `Control.Applicative.WrappedMonad`, which can be used to convert a
+    `Monad` to an `Applicative`, has now a
+    `Monad m => Monad (WrappedMonad m)` instance.
+
+  * There is now a `Generic` and a `Generic1` instance for `WrappedMonad`
+    and `WrappedArrow`.
+
+  * Handle `ExitFailure (-sig)` on Unix by killing process with signal `sig`.
+
+  * New module `Data.Type.Bool` providing operations on type-level booleans.
+
+  * Expose `System.Mem.performMinorGC` for triggering minor GCs.
+
+  * New `System.Environment.{set,unset}Env` for manipulating
+    environment variables.
+
+  * Add `Typeable` instance for `(->)` and `RealWorld`.
+
+  * Declare CPP header `<Typeable.h>` officially obsolete as GHC 7.8+
+    does not support hand-written `Typeable` instances anymore.
+
+  * Remove (unmaintained) Hugs98 and NHC98 specific code.
+
+  * Optimize `System.Timeout.timeout` for the threaded RTS.
+
+  * Remove deprecated functions `unsafeInterleaveST`, `unsafeIOToST`,
+    and `unsafeSTToIO` from `Control.Monad.ST`.
+
+  * Add a new superclass `SomeAsyncException` for all asynchronous exceptions
+    and makes the existing `AsyncException` and `Timeout` exception children
+    of `SomeAsyncException` in the hierarchy.
+
+  * Remove deprecated functions `blocked`, `unblock`, and `block` from
+    `Control.Exception`.
+
+  * Remove deprecated function `forkIOUnmasked` from `Control.Concurrent`.
+
+  * Remove deprecated function `unsafePerformIO` export from `Foreign`
+    (still available via `System.IO.Unsafe.unsafePerformIO`).
+
+  * Various fixes and other improvements (see Git history for full details).
